Dunedin Airport overview

Dunedin International Airport (DUD) serves Dunedin, New Zealand. It is listed as a regional airport, so this guide focuses on practical location context, airport identifiers, nearby alternates, and the details travelers can verify before planning a route through DUD.

The airport sits at 4 feet above sea level. Its coordinates are -45.9290, 170.1978, which helps travelers compare the airport with city access points and other airports in New Zealand.

Nearby alternatives include Alexandra Aerodrome (ALR) and Oamaru Airport (OAM). Compare those pages when checking backup airports, local access, or regional routing across Oceania.
